repo.or.cz
/
openal-soft
/
openal-hmr.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
Don't needlessly verify a device
2012-03-13
Chri
s
R
obinson
Try
t
o ensure at least 2 mmdevapi updates
commit
|
commitdiff
|
tree
2012-03-13
Chris Robi
n
son
Try to find a
mul
t
iple of
m
mdevapi's
p
e
riod siz
e
nearest
.
.
.
commit
|
commitdiff
|
tree
2012-03-13
Chr
i
s Robinson
Restore the FPU mode in an error path
commit
|
commitdiff
|
tree
2012-03-13
Ch
r
is R
o
binson
R
ev
e
rt
the defa
u
lt st
e
reo layou
t
back to -90 and +90
.
.
.
commit
|
commitdiff
|
tree
2012-03-13
Chris Robins
o
n
Finalize AL
_
SOF
T
_direct_channels
commit
|
commitdiff
|
tree
2012-03-13
Chris Robinso
n
Attempted
fix for the
c
oreaudio backend
commit
|
commitdiff
|
tree
2012-03-13
C
h
ris Robinson
Sim
p
ly (
h
opefuly) the ex
p
lan
a
tion ab
o
ut the HRIR set
.
.
.
commit
|
commitdiff
|
tree
2012-03-13
Chris Robinson
C
h
annel an
g
le
is
a
lready i
n
r
adia
n
s,
n
ot
d
e
grees
commit
|
commitdiff
|
tree
2012-03-13
Chris Robinson
With Direc
t
Cha
n
nels e
n
a
bled,
do
n
't try to mix cha
n
nels
.
.
.
commit
|
commitdiff
|
tree
2012-03-13
Ch
r
is Robin
s
on
Some HRTF clarific
a
tions
commit
|
commitdiff
|
tree
2012-03-13
C
h
ris R
o
bins
o
n
F
i
x typo
commit
|
commitdiff
|
tree
2012-03-13
Chris Rob
i
ns
o
n
Ad
d
a note abo
u
t
the HRTF data bein
g
minimum-pha
s
e
.
.
.
commit
|
commitdiff
|
tree
2012-03-12
Chris Robinson
Reset HAVE_MM
D
EVAP
I
before checki
n
g
the backends
commit
|
commitdiff
|
tree
2012-03-12
Chris Robinson
Don't as
s
u
m
e th
e
calculated HRTF delta for the gain
.
.
.
commit
|
commitdiff
|
tree
2012-03-12
C
h
r
i
s Robinson
Remove
a
n
u
n
us
e
d property key d
e
finition
commit
|
commitdiff
|
tree
2012-03-12
Chris Robinso
n
Minor correct
i
o
ns to the hrtf
.
txt
commit
|
commitdiff
|
tree
2012-03-12
Chris Rob
i
nson
D
ocument the hrtf_tables c
o
nfig opti
o
n
commit
|
commitdiff
|
tree
2012-03-12
Chris Robinson
Add a tex
t
file explaining
O
penAL Soft's HRTF support
.
.
.
commit
|
commitdiff
|
tree
2012-03-10
Ch
r
is Robin
s
on
Properly m
a
ke th
e
s
o
urce velocity relative
t
o the
l
i
ste
n
e
r
.
.
.
commit
|
commitdiff
|
tree
2012-03-10
Ch
r
is
Robin
s
on
C
lamp the upper and lower boun
d
of
the do
p
pler velocity
.
.
.
commit
|
commitdiff
|
tree
2012-03-09
C
hris Robin
s
o
n
Th
e
listener
velocity is specified i
n
world
coordinates
.
.
.
commit
|
commitdiff
|
tree
2012-03-09
Chris Robins
o
n
Refactor the doppler s
h
ift calcula
t
ions
commit
|
commitdiff
|
tree
2012-03-09
C
hris Robins
o
n
P
i
n
the DLL f
o
r Windows
commit
|
commitdiff
|
tree
2012-03-06
Chris R
o
b
i
nson
Store a duplicate
of t
h
e mmdevapi device ID
commit
|
commitdiff
|
tree
2012-03-06
Chris
R
obinson
Add
a
comm
e
nt explaining the pulseaudio prop_filter
commit
|
commitdiff
|
tree
2012-03-06
Chris Robin
s
o
n
U
pdate the ALCdevice in wi
n
mm's rese
t
m
e
t
h
o
d instead
.
.
.
commit
|
commitdiff
|
tree
2012-03-05
Chris Robinson
M
a
rk the device as run
n
i
n
g
for capt
u
re
,
too
commit
|
commitdiff
|
tree
2012-03-05
Chris Rob
i
nson
Hold the list lock wh
i
l
e
calling the backend
commit
|
commitdiff
|
tree
2012-03-05
Chr
i
s Rob
i
nson
F
ilter
o
ut a couple pulsea
u
dio s
t
ream properties by
.
.
.
commit
|
commitdiff
|
tree
2012-03-05
Chris R
o
binson
Ret
u
rned p
a
_operat
i
ons
c
an be NULL
commit
|
commitdiff
|
tree
2012-03-05
Chris
Robinson
U
se a separate backend callback
t
o start p
l
ay
b
ack of
.
.
.
commit
|
commitdiff
|
tree
2012-03-05
C
h
ris Robinson
Avoid some
uninitialized w
a
rnings
commit
|
commitdiff
|
tree
2012-03-05
Chris R
o
b
inson
Print
a
n
d
handle errors from pa_stre
a
m_reada
b
le_siz
e
commit
|
commitdiff
|
tree
2012-03-04
Chris Robins
o
n
Set prebuf to
0 since we'
r
e ha
n
dling th
e
s
tre
a
m
s
tart
.
.
.
commit
|
commitdiff
|
tree
2012-03-04
Chr
i
s Robinson
E
n
forc
e
range limits o
n
p
eriods an
d
p
e
riod_size
.
commit
|
commitdiff
|
tree
2012-03-04
Chris R
o
bi
n
s
o
n
Make
sur
e
the pulse stream is
p
roperly
s
ta
r
ted
a
nd
.
.
.
commit
|
commitdiff
|
tree
2012-03-03
Ch
r
is Robin
s
on
Invert a nested loop
commit
|
commitdiff
|
tree
2012-03-03
C
hri
s
Rob
i
n
s
o
n
H
andle BS2B c
r
oss-feed right
after
c
lick removal
commit
|
commitdiff
|
tree
2012-03-03
C
hris Robin
s
on
Slight correction for handl
i
ng the wave
wr
i
t
er backend
.
.
.
commit
|
commitdiff
|
tree
2012-03-03
Chris Robins
o
n
Sl
i
ght correction for handl
i
ng
the null backen
d
'
s
t
imer
.
.
.
commit
|
commitdiff
|
tree
2012-03-02
Ch
r
is R
o
binson
Remove some unneeded pulseaudi
o
cal
l
s
commit
|
commitdiff
|
tree
2012-03-02
Chris
Robins
o
n
Don't unload libp
u
lse
commit
|
commitdiff
|
tree
2012-03-02
C
hris Rob
i
ns
o
n
Remove s
o
m
e
unneeded markers
commit
|
commitdiff
|
tree
2012-03-02
Chris Robinson
Set pre
b
u
f
t
o the exp
e
ct
e
d buffer size
commit
|
commitdiff
|
tree
2012-03-02
C
hris Robinson
Don't rely on PulseA
u
d
io to
wake us up
using early
.
.
.
commit
|
commitdiff
|
tree
2012-03-02
Ch
r
is Rob
i
nson
Avoid a lea
k
if
PortAudio fail
s
to g
i
ve
a
u
sable channel
.
.
.
commit
|
commitdiff
|
tree
2012-03-02
Chris
Robi
n
so
n
Mak
e
sure the d
e
vice gets stopped
when
clos
i
ng
even
.
.
.
commit
|
commitdiff
|
tree
2012-03-02
Chr
i
s
Robinso
n
Recalcul
a
t
e
the new
upd
a
te size u
s
ing the de
v
ice
'
s
.
.
.
commit
|
commitdiff
|
tree
2012-03-02
Chris Robinso
n
A
v
oid an unnecess
a
ry do
C
aptur
e
c
h
eck
commit
|
commitdiff
|
tree
2012-03-01
Ch
r
is
R
obin
s
on
Update the l
a
y
o
u
t
co
n
fig
o
p
tion
n
ame
s
commit
|
commitdiff
|
tree
2012-03-01
Chri
s
Ro
b
inson
F
i
x a mem
o
r
y
leak
commit
|
commitdiff
|
tree
2012-03-01
Chris Ro
b
inson
Set the
f
unc list aft
e
r success
f
ully
c
onnecting to
.
.
.
commit
|
commitdiff
|
tree
2012-03-01
Chris Ro
b
inson
M
a
ke
a
lcLoopbackOpenDeviceSOFT t
a
ke a standard
"
devi
c
e
.
.
.
commit
|
commitdiff
|
tree
2012-03-01
C
h
ris Robinson
Pr
i
nt out
a
m
ore des
c
r
ip
t
ive nam
e
f
o
r
t
he opened
d
e
vice
.
.
.
commit
|
commitdiff
|
tree
2012-03-01
Chris Ro
b
inson
Don't use GUIDs to ID
mmde
v
a
p
i devices, and don't enumerat
e
.
.
.
commit
|
commitdiff
|
tree
2012-03-01
Chri
s
R
o
binson
A
v
oid enumerating when opening the
default ALSA de
v
ice
commit
|
commitdiff
|
tree
2012-03-01
Chris Rob
i
nson
U
s
e
NULL
t
o open t
h
e d
e
fault PulseAudio devi
c
e, and
.
.
.
commit
|
commitdiff
|
tree
2012-03-01
Chris Ro
b
inson
Move some fun
c
tio
n
def
i
n
ition
s
d
o
wn
commit
|
commitdiff
|
tree
2012-03-01
C
h
ri
s
R
obinson
Don
'
t defi
n
e l
i
b hand
l
es when dynami
c
l
o
ading is dis
a
b
led
commit
|
commitdiff
|
tree
2012-03-01
Chris R
o
b
inson
Only
s
upport PA_AP
I
_VE
R
SION 1
2
commit
|
commitdiff
|
tree
2012-03-01
Chris Robin
s
on
Up
d
a
t
e
t
h
e
stored
b
uffer attributes if PulseAudio changes it
commit
|
commitdiff
|
tree
2012-03-01
Chris Robinso
n
Don
'
t allo
w
the Pu
l
s
eAud
i
o stream to move
commit
|
commitdiff
|
tree
2012-03-01
Chris
Robinson
D
on't force
a
sample spec w
h
en look
i
ng for th
e
de
f
ault
.
.
.
commit
|
commitdiff
|
tree
2012-03-01
C
h
ri
s
R
obinson
D
o
n't c
h
eck if the pulseaud
i
o s
i
nk
i
s
suspe
n
ded
whe
n
.
.
.
commit
|
commitdiff
|
tree
2012-03-01
Chris Rob
i
nson
Constify a couple string pointers
commit
|
commitdiff
|
tree
2012-03-01
C
h
ris Robi
n
son
Look for
and enu
m
e
rate the
d
e
fault PulseAudio sou
r
ce
.
.
.
commit
|
commitdiff
|
tree
2012-03-01
Chris Robinso
n
Use
a separate fun
c
t
i
on to create
and conn
e
ct a
PulseAudio
.
.
.
commit
|
commitdiff
|
tree
2012-03-01
C
h
ris Rob
i
nson
Look f
o
r an
d
e
n
u
merate the
d
efault PulseAu
d
io sink
.
.
.
commit
|
commitdiff
|
tree
2012-03-01
Chris
R
obinson
Avoi
d
enu
m
erating multiple devices w
i
th the same
n
ame
commit
|
commitdiff
|
tree
2012-03-01
C
h
ri
s
Robinson
Avoi
d
passing
t
he ALC
d
e
vice
to
c
onnect
_
p
layba
c
k_stream
commit
|
commitdiff
|
tree
2012-03-01
Chris Robinson
Print
the en
u
me
r
a
t
ed d
e
v
ices from PulseAudio
commit
|
commitdiff
|
tree
2012-03-01
Chri
s
Rob
i
n
s
on
Minor clean
u
ps for
O
SS an
d
Solaris
commit
|
commitdiff
|
tree
2012-02-29
C
hri
s
Rob
i
nson
Allow read
i
n
g
au
d
io fro
m
ALSA directl
y
if the request
e
d
.
.
.
commit
|
commitdiff
|
tree
2012-02-29
Chris Rob
i
n
s
on
D
o
n't store the frame
s
ize with pulse_data
commit
|
commitdiff
|
tree
2012-02-29
C
h
ris Ro
b
inson
R
e
ad
c
a
p
ture data from pulseaudio as
n
eeded, avoiding
.
.
.
commit
|
commitdiff
|
tree
2012-02-29
Chris Robinson
G
e
t and release
t
he mmde
v
api
r
ender client ifac
e
on
.
.
.
commit
|
commitdiff
|
tree
2012-02-29
Ch
r
is Robinson
Use local variables to determine how m
u
ch
to write
.
.
.
commit
|
commitdiff
|
tree
2012-02-28
C
hris Robinson
Print o
u
t unsup
p
orte
d
audio
form
a
t inf
o
from ffmpeg
commit
|
commitdiff
|
tree
2012-02-28
Chris Robinson
Give "OpenAL
S
o
f
t"
f
or the standard
d
evi
c
e name
commit
|
commitdiff
|
tree
2012-02-28
Chri
s
Robin
s
on
Trace t
h
e name
of the
crea
t
ed device
commit
|
commitdiff
|
tree
2012-02-27
C
hris Robins
o
n
U
s
e a switch to h
a
ndl
e
the ALSA
PCM
s
tate
commit
|
commitdiff
|
tree
2012-02-27
C
hris Robinson
Print
enumerated ALSA devices
commit
|
commitdiff
|
tree
2012-02-27
Ch
r
i
s Robinso
n
Pri
n
t enum
e
r
a
ted dsound devices
commit
|
commitdiff
|
tree
2012-02-27
Chris R
o
b
i
n
so
n
Watch f
o
r unsupported sample t
y
pes for
ds
o
und capture
commit
|
commitdiff
|
tree
2012-02-27
Chris Robins
o
n
P
rint the m
m
devapi device and G
U
ID found
commit
|
commitdiff
|
tree
2012-02-26
Chris
R
obinson
Use separate loops
for ge
t
ting
and c
h
ecking
d
evice
.
.
.
commit
|
commitdiff
|
tree
2012-02-24
C
hris Ro
b
i
nson
W
a
t
c
h
f
or CLSIDFro
m
S
tr
i
n
g
errors
commit
|
commitdiff
|
tree
2012-02-23
C
hris Rob
i
nson
Use an en
u
m for the dev
i
ce type
commit
|
commitdiff
|
tree
2012-02-23
Chri
s
Robinson
Print a message when loadin
g
the "no
n
e" reverb preset
commit
|
commitdiff
|
tree
2012-02-23
Chris Robi
n
son
Minor rearran
g
e
m
ents for
the
p
u
l
seau
d
io mixin
g
loop
commit
|
commitdiff
|
tree
2012-02-23
Chris Ro
b
inson
Remove an unneeded wrappe
r
commit
|
commitdiff
|
tree
2012-02-22
Chris R
o
b
i
nson
U
se the stored minreq si
z
e from Puls
e
Audio for r
o
und
i
ng
.
.
.
commit
|
commitdiff
|
tree
2012-02-21
C
h
ris Ro
b
inson
Only probe fo
r
dev
i
ce
s
w
h
en a back
e
nd is loade
d
commit
|
commitdiff
|
tree
2012-02-21
Chris Robins
o
n
A
v
oid default names
f
or winmm and dsound
commit
|
commitdiff
|
tree
2012-02-21
C
h
ris
R
obinson
Avoid usi
n
g a default name w
i
th the MMDevApi
backen
d
commit
|
commitdiff
|
tree
2012-02-21
Chris Ro
b
in
s
on
A
v
o
i
d using a defaul
t
name wh
e
n
opening a PulseAudio
.
.
.
commit
|
commitdiff
|
tree
2012-02-21
Chr
i
s
Robinson
Se
t
the default A
L
S
A
d
e
vice name when prob
i
n
g
commit
|
commitdiff
|
tree
2012-02-21
Chris Robins
o
n
A
l
ways u
s
e "OpenAL S
o
f
t" for the sho
r
t de
v
ice enumera
t
ion
.
.
.
commit
|
commitdiff
|
tree
2012-02-21
Chris Robinso
n
Don't ac
c
ept the pulseau
d
io
d
efault
n
a
me fo
r
cap
t
ure
commit
|
commitdiff
|
tree
2012-02-21
Chris R
o
b
i
nson
Us
e
a
string
to r
e
port un
s
upported c
a
ptur
e
sample types
commit
|
commitdiff
|
tree
next